Title :
Research on MRP/JIT integration and application in medical equipment production management concerned with spare part manufacturing

Abstract :
In the electromechanical production industry, especially in medical equipment manufactories, the mixed production of the original equipment and the maintenance spare part is very common. The implementation priority of the original equipment is higher than the maintenance spare part. In addition, the implementation and control of the production planning of maintenance spare part are restricted by the original equipment production. They could lead to the failure of the spare part´s production planning. In order to solve this type of problem, this paper proposes the MRP/JIT integration solution that can be applied in workshop production. In this solution, the production of the original equipment is controlled by MRP, while the spare part by JIT. The work flow of the material supply is also reengineered with material procurement Kanban and material requirement Kanban. The result showed that the feasibility of the production planning had been improved.
